About Ash Flat Campground

Rising above the typical expectations of small forest campgrounds, Ash Flat Campground in Tiller, Oregon, offers a serene escape with its intimate setting of just four campsites, thoughtfully equipped with picnic tables, fire pits, and a backdrop of mixed conifers and hardwoods. This gem within the Umpqua National Forest provides an ideal retreat for those seeking solitude, stargazing, and a profound connection to nature.

The campground’s simplicity highlights its charm—vault toilets and garbage disposal are provided, but visitors should bring their own drinking water. Surrounded by the rich biodiversity of the National Forest, it serves as a great base for exploring nearby natural wonders like the South Umpqua River and its quiet trails, all within a short drive. Whether you're on a weekend getaway or a brief road trip stop, Ash Flat Campground offers a rustic, tranquil escape for true outdoor enthusiasts.
